Chapter 42: Shiomi Ice Lake Tour

“The Train is about to arrive at the station. Please be seated and hold on tight.”

Xi Jian was woken by the broadcast and reluctantly poked her head out from under the covers.

She groggily threw off the blanket, shook her disheveled hair, and got up to go to the initial carriage.

“Air conditioning is truly humanity’s greatest invention!”

Xi Jian left her door open; the first two carriages were very warm.

Through the window, she saw a vast ice lake outside.

“Wow, an ice lake! Looks like I don’t need to go out today.”

Picking up four train coins from the floor, Xi Jian took a deep breath and transferred three to Qi Xiao.

Clutching the last remaining coin, she forced herself to hold back her tears.

Every day I have to give this scoundrel three train coins. What kind of ally is this? He’s completely exploiting me!

Just think of it as buying food, just think of it as buying food.

Xi Jian comforted herself this way every day.

Chewing on the bread Qi Xiao had sent her, Xi Jian felt even more wronged.

“Today I want milk! Hot milk!”

Before she could even send the message, it showed that Qi Xiao had transferred another bottle of milk and a roasted pumpkin.

Xi Jian got her hot milk, and the corners of her mouth, which had been pouting from feeling wronged, straightened out.

Hmph, at least you have some conscience.

Qi Xiao: “Which station?”

Xi Jian deleted the unsent message and re-edited it:

“Glacial Island, on an ice lake.”

“Even if you’ve been there, I’m not going out. It’s finally warm here.”

“Besides, there aren’t any resources here. I can’t exactly go dig for ice, can I?”

Xi Jian poured a bottle of hot milk into the roasted pumpkin and ate it with bread.

“I’ve actually been to this one. There’s a Level 3 treasure chest in the center of the lake that can yield 12 train coins.”

Pfft.

Xi Jian saw Qi Xiao’s message and spat out a mouthful of milk.

She wiped her mouth with the back of her hand:

“You’re not lying to me, are you?”

“Please tell me, what reason would I have to deceive an ally?”

“You can also stay in the carriage. Maybe someone will pull the treasure chest directly to you in a while.”

“Do you take me for an idiot? How could there be such a good thing?”

Xi Jian pouted, quickly finished her breakfast, changed into the thick clothes Qi Xiao had given her earlier, grabbed her revolver, and walked out of the Train.

Twelve train coins! That’s a lot!

And she wouldn’t have to share it with that big oaf; it would be her own twelve train coins.

Woohoo, I’m taking off!

Hiss, it’s so cold…

Xi Jian hugged her arms.

The center of the lake, where exactly is the center of the lake?

Xi Jian hadn’t walked more than two steps when she saw a box-shaped object under the ice surface at her feet.

She bent down to examine it; it was indeed a treasure chest.

I really am a favored child of destiny! This treasure chest is right next to my Train!

Xi Jian knocked on the ice surface and immediately deflated.

This ice is thicker than my life!

Xi Jian immediately returned to the Train and told Qi Xiao that she had found the treasure chest, but the ice was too thick, and asked if there was a solution.

Qi Xiao transferred a shotgun to her.

“Infinite bullets, but the recoil is a bit strong. You can try it first.”

Infinite bullets? Where did he get them? Do those even exist in reality?

“Ah—!!!”

A girl’s scream suddenly came from outside, and Xi Jian quickly took out the shotgun and went out.

A small girl was being relentlessly pursued by a white bear.

Seeing the distance between the white bear and the girl getting closer and closer, Xi Jian directly pulled out her revolver and fired a shot.

The girl fell down in fright, while the white bear changed direction and charged towards Xi Jian.

“Roar!!!”

Xi Jian raised the shotgun and fired a shot.

The recoil knocked her backward, and she landed on the ground with a thud.

The white bear didn’t fare much better; it took a direct hit to the front, and blood stained its fur.

This also ignited its fury, and it raised its paw to strike down heavily at Xi Jian.

Xi Jian did a somersault, barely dodging while clutching the shotgun.

She leaned her body against the carriage to brace against the shotgun’s recoil and fired another shot at the white bear.

This time, it hit the white bear’s abdomen. It cried out in pain and tried to flee, but it didn’t run far before its body swayed, and it lay down on the ice.

It was dead.

Xi Jian held the shotgun, breathing heavily, with white mist rising.

So I’m this powerful.

Xi Jian went to the girl’s side and helped her up.

The girl was clearly overly frightened; after Xi Jian woke her, she was still screaming “Help, help” repeatedly.

Xi Jian was a postgraduate student in languages from a prestigious university, mastering multiple languages, and this now came in handy.

She gently patted the girl’s back, comforting her:

“It’s okay, it’s okay. Look, the bear is dead.”

The girl looked in the direction Xi Jian pointed and saw the white bear lying motionless on the ground.

“My name is Xi Jian. What’s your name?”

“My name is Sheryl, big sister. Did you kill the bear?”

“Yes, I did.”

“Wow, big sister is so amazing!”

Just then, a man appeared on the lake on a dog-pulled sled, loudly calling out Sheryl’s name.

“Papa, I’m here! Here!”

Sheryl quickly got up, waving and shouting.

The man stopped the sled, got off, and hugged Sheryl tightly, tears streaming down his face.

“Papa, I’m sorry. I shouldn’t have snuck out by myself.”

Sheryl told Winnifred about being chased by the white bear.

“This big sister saved me.”

Xi Jian smiled as she watched the two. Winnifred released Sheryl, wiped away his tears, stood up, and thanked Xi Jian.

Winnifred strongly invited Xi Jian to his home as a guest, but Xi Jian quickly declined.

“I still have things to do. I appreciate your kind offer.”

With that, Xi Jian returned to the treasure chest.

She had only fired two shots just now, and she still hadn’t recovered.

Xi Jian raised the gun and fired a shot at the ice surface.

Aside from leaving a white mark, it only chipped off a little ice.

“Big sister, are you trying to break the ice?”

Sheryl had followed her at some point.

At this moment, Winnifred also dragged the white bear to Xi Jian’s side.

He meant that this was Xi Jian’s hunt, and she should take it.

“Papa, can you help Big Sister Xi Jian break the ice here?”

Winnifred nodded repeatedly, saying it was no problem.

He just needed to go home and get some tools.

“Really? That’s great! I don’t want this bear; you can take it back. Just help me break this ice, please.”

And so, Xi Jian returned to the Train to wait for Winnifred to come back with the tools.

“Big sister, your Train has such a unique shape.”

“And it’s so warm, so comfortable.”

Sheryl really liked the Train, running back and forth inside.

“Wow, this hat is so pretty.”

“Do you like it? It’s yours.”

Xi Jian put the red knitted hat on Sheryl, and it matched Sheryl’s rosy cheeks perfectly.

“Thank you, big sister.”

Sheryl happily hugged Xi Jian.

An hour and a half later, Winnifred’s sled appeared in Xi Jian’s sight.

He had returned with ice-breaking tools.

Having professional tools made a difference; in just one hour, the meter-thick ice layer was broken.

Xi Jian saw the treasure chest in the water and happily clenched her fist.

Yes, it’s mine!

But just as Winnifred lowered the grappling hook to lift the treasure chest, an undercurrent suddenly surged beneath the ice, carrying the treasure chest more than ten meters away.

The treasure chest was once again covered by thick ice.

Xi Jian froze, and then her whole body instantly deflated like a punctured balloon, slumping down.

To retrieve it now would require breaking the ice again, but the Train was departing in half an hour.

Twelve o’clock.

“The Train is departing. Please be seated and hold on tight.”

Xi Jian lay on the Simmons mattress, her body trembling from sobbing, tears falling incessantly:

“My treasure chest! ┭┮﹏┭┮”

Shortly after Xi Jian left, Winnifred broke through the ice again.

This time, he successfully hooked the treasure chest.

This treasure chest was strange; it had no lock, but it just wouldn’t open.

“Papa, can we come back tomorrow? Maybe Big Sister Xi Jian will be back.”

Winnifred affectionately stroked Sheryl’s head. They tied the treasure chest to the sled and dragged the white bear home.

The next day, they dragged the treasure chest back to the ice lake.

This time, a red Train was parked by the ice lake.
